Arizona has some of the most beautiful outdoor wedding venues in the country, but they come with streaming challenges. We bring our own cellular bonding equipment that creates a reliable internet connection independent of venue wifi, which is essential for desert venues, ranch weddings, garden ceremonies, and mountaintop locations where network access is limited. We also handle outdoor audio challenges like wind, distance, and open air PA systems so your stream sounds as clean as it looks.

Pricing depends on the number of cameras, ceremony length, whether you need outdoor or cellular bonding equipment, and whether you want reception coverage or a combined highlight video package. Most wedding livestreams in the Phoenix area range from $900 to $3,500. Request a quote for an exact number based on your specific day.
